Output 58e6d0cb2f8e5781088dd3f1bf6fd6774ddf6d89dc21fcee58e6a904b4bccba7:2

value
1357532
script pubkey
OP_0 OP_PUSHBYTES_20 e0abdcff59be56be5f9b10320f5662ebd9f07643
address
bc1quz4ael6ehettuhumzqeq74nza0vlqajr7h8ruv
transaction
58e6d0cb2f8e5781088dd3f1bf6fd6774ddf6d89dc21fcee58e6a904b4bccba7